Understanding the Importance of Employment Attestation Letters
An employment attestation letter is a document that verifies an individual’s employment status, position, and other relevant details. This letter is often required for various purposes, such as visa applications, loan approvals, or background checks. Common Scenarios Requiring an Employment Attestation Letter
An employment attestation letter may be required in various situations, such as:
| Scenario | Description |
|---|---|
| Visa Applications | To verify employment status and eligibility for a visa. |
| Loan Approvals | To verify income and employment stability for loan applications. |
| Background Checks | To verify employment history and provide a reference. |
| Professional Certifications | To verify employment experience and qualifications. |

Common Mistakes to Avoid in an Employment Attestation Letter
When creating an employment attestation letter, avoid:
- Inaccurate or incomplete information.
- Unprofessional tone or language.
- Failure to verify information.
- Inconsistent formatting or branding.
